The amount of nitrogen oxide (4) NO2 substance is 5 mol. Perform all possible formula calculations.

Knowing the amount of tetravalent nitric oxide substance, you can carry out the following calculations, with me the formulas:
1. Calculate the mass of nitric oxide using the following formula:
n = m / M
m = n × M
We consider the molar mass of nitrogen oxide
M = 14 + 16 × 2 = 46 g / mol
m (NO2) = 5 × 46 = 230 g
This means that the mass of nitrogen oxide is 230 grams.
2. You can also calculate the volume of nitric oxide using the following formula:
n = V / Vm
We express V, V = n × Vm
V (NO2) = 5 × 22.4 = 112 l
The volume of nitric oxide is 112 liters.
3. You can also calculate the number of molecules:
N = n × Na
N (NO2) = 5 × 6 × 10 ^ 23 = 30 × 10 ^ 23
